Hasina: One medical university in each division

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ina has said one medical university will be built in every division of Bangladesh with the aim of providing modern medical services to people at their doorsteps. The prime minister made the statement while addressing the 13th Convocation of Bangladesh College of Physicians and Surgeons held at Krishibid Institution auditorium on Wednesday afternoon. “People are enjoying the fruits of various measures taken by our government in the medical sector. We have provided the public with free treatment and medicine and ensured medical service especially in the village, union and upazila levels.” Talking about the Digital Bangladesh agenda, Hasina said: “We taken measures to built a digital Bangladesh. Web cameras have been installed in every hospital and we are also providing medical service through mobile phones. “We made mobile phones available after coming to power. The foreign minister of previous BNP-led government was using it for personal business.” The premier said: “We have appointed 12,728 surgeons and 108 dental surgeons and the process of appointing more people is under way.” She said nurses were also sent to Singapore for training so that they can provide better treatment to people. “Various initiatives have been taken to improve the treatment facilities at Dhaka Medical College Hospital and Bangabandhu Sheikh Mujib Medical University and we have built specialised hospitals like National Institute of Eye Science and Hospital, Cancer Institute and National Institute of Neurosciences Hospital as a part of the initiative,” she said, adding that separate hospitals were also built for public servants and police officials.
